Protective effect of genistein on acute light damage induced by UVA in fibroblasts cells

Abstract: Objective: To determine the protective effect of genistein on acute light damage induced by UVA in fibroblasts cells. Methods: Fibroblasts cells cultured in vitro were divided into the control group, UVA group and UVA +0.01,0.1,1,10,100 μmol/L genistein group. The proliferation activity, apoptosis rate and the level of Sirt1mRNA were detected by the cck8 experiment method, flow cytometry and RT-PCR, respectively. Results: Compared with the UVA group, the proliferation activity and the level of Sirt1mRNA in the UVA+ 0.01,0.1,1,10μmol/L genistein group was significantly increased and the apoptosis rate was significantly decreased (Ps<0.05), while there was no significant difference in apoptosis rate between the UVA +100 umol/L genistein group and UVA group (P>0.05). Conclusion: 0.01-10 μmol/L genistein is effective in protecting the fibroblasts cells from acute light damage induced by UVA.
